here is the bottom line, KFA is desperatly looking for qualified ex-pats, Indigo also, and spice jet. what the mod is saying is exactly correct, instead of creating malice and bitterness the local media and pilots should inform the youngsters the quagmire they are heading into,--- like most of the indian carriers charge (can you believe) 18/20 lakks (about 38,000usd) just to hire them, they make them sign checks and as they work them off they tear them up, i have friends in KFA that would love to leave but they can`t get noc`s and they owe to much money. plus the myriad of utterly ridiculous procedures and laws that just make things confusing and difficult for not only young pilots but ex-pats, and even local qualified people.
examples;--
medicals only done by air force docs
difficult ALTP exams and no study material.
ridiculous questions in the indian air law exam (what is the incubation time for the TB germ/virius) yeah rite
no unions so company mostly does as it pleases
etc etc
also the DGCA is so disorganised even he doesn`t know which duty time limitations are in force, and those duty times are extreme 30 hours a week block to block=120 hours a month (28 days) thats a hard job in any country.
